MySQL中的Blob類型是一種用于存儲二進制數據的數據類型。它可以存儲任何類型的數據,視頻等。在本文中,我們將詳細介紹MySQL中的Blob類型。
1. Blob類型的定義
Blob類型是MySQL中一種二進制數據類型,用于存儲大型的二進制數據。它可以存儲任何類型的數據,視頻等。Blob類型有四種類型:TINYBLOB、BLOB、MEDIUMBLOB和LONGBLOB。它們分別可以存儲的最大數據量為255字節、65535字節、16777215字節和4294967295字節。
2. Blob類型的使用方法
Blob類型可以用于存儲任何類型的數據,但是需要注意以下幾點:
(1)在創建表時,需要指定列的類型為Blob類型。
(2)在插入數據時,需要使用Blob類型的值。
(3)在查詢數據時,需要使用Blob類型的值。
3. Blob類型的優缺點
Blob類型的優點是可以存儲任何類型的數據,視頻等等。但是,Blob類型的缺點也很明顯。首先,Blob類型的存儲效率不高,因為它需要占用大量的存儲空間。其次,Blob類型的查詢速度也較慢,因為它需要進行大量的數據處理。
4. Blob類型的應用場景
Blob類型適用于需要存儲大型二進制數據的場景,比如圖像、視頻等等。它可以存儲這些數據,并且能夠保證數據的完整性和安全性。
Blob類型是MySQL中一種用于存儲大型二進制數據的數據類型。雖然它有一些缺點,但是在某些場景下,它是不可替代的。如果您需要存儲大型二進制數據,請考慮使用Blob類型。
上一篇css全民